Reduction of angular divergence of laser-driven ion beams during their acceleration and transport
Original language description
Laser plasma physics is a field of big interest because of its implications in basic science, fast ignition, medicine (i.e. hadrontherapy), astrophysics, material science, particle acceleration etc. 100-MeV class protons accelerated from the interactionof a short laser pulse with a thin target have been demonstrated.
